High-power flat air nozzle
The 1-in. high-power flat super air nozzle produces a flat 1-in.-wide airstream with a strong blowing force of 16 oz when mounted 12 in. from the target. The nozzles maximize entrained airflow while reducing noise levels. A precise amount of air is released through the 0.025-in. air gap opening, set with a stainless-steel shim positioned between the body and removable cap. The airstream pulls in surrounding room air to produce a wide, forceful stream of high-velocity, laminar airflow. Air consumption is 17.5 scfm at 80 psig. The 82-dBA sound level is below the OSHA maximum allowable noise exposure standard. Force and flow may be adjusted by installing different shim thicknesses. The nozzle is available in zinc-aluminum alloy
